Working independently and exercising good judgment and discretion, the Office Work Assist is directly responsible to, and assists, Directors, Assistant Directors, and senior staff members in whatever areas deemed necessary. It is the duty of each DOS staff member to keep the Dean of Students, the senior staff members, and/or the Administrative Assistant abreast of any discipline, personal, physical, or emotional problems involving the student population. Additionally, the Administrative Assistant is responsible for updating electronic files and keeping complete and accurate records of student situations.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Manage Data – Assist with data entry, including but not limited to, student appointments, email and phone referrals, updates to student records, group and event attendance, and training initiatives.
Manage the Reception Area – This includes, but is not limited to, swiping appointments, routing visitors, filtering questions, answering phone calls, distributing mail, scheduling meetings, providing front desk coverage, and communicating any emergencies to a full-time CARE staff member.
Maintain the Office Suite – This includes, but is not limited to, maintaining an organized and well-stocked office supply closet, maintaining an organized lobby, waiting area, lounge, and group rooms, restocking refreshments, notifying the Associate Director and Senior Associate Director of any office supply needs, and light cleaning, as needed.
Research – Assist the Associate Director and Senior Associate Director with research surrounding recovery programming, policies, and procedures.
Administration – Help maintain and manage the recovery inbox and assist with marketing and promotional tasks.
Manage confidential information and record keeping practices in accordance with the Family Education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A).
Collaborate with other CARE staff regarding case information, communication with Liberty community members, communication with external parties, etc.
Strictly adhere to Liberty University policies, representing the University in an exemplary manner.
Work effectively as a team member, embracing and fostering LU’s Christian model and Mission – Training Champions for Christ.
